# Document Generation Example
AI-powered document generation using the Claude Agent SDK and Elixir.
> **Reference:** This example is inspired by the [claude-agent-sdk-demos](https://github.com/anthropics/claude-agent-sdk-demos) project, specifically the Excel demo and resume generator demos.
## What This Example Demonstrates
This Mix application showcases how to:
- Generate professional Excel spreadsheets programmatically using `elixlsx`
- Integrate with Claude Agent SDK for AI-powered document creation
- Parse natural language specifications into structured data
- Create multi-sheet workbooks with formulas and professional styling
- Build reusable document templates (budget trackers, workout logs)
## Features
### Excel Generation (`DocumentGeneration.Excel`)
- **Multi-sheet workbooks** - Create workbooks with multiple related sheets
- **Formula support** - Add Excel formulas with proper syntax (`=SUM(A1:A10)`)
- **Professional styling** - Headers, colors, borders, number formatting
- **Currency/percentage formatting** - Proper display of financial data
- **Frozen panes** - Keep headers visible while scrolling
- **Row/column sizing** - Custom widths and heights
### AI-Powered Generation (`DocumentGeneration.ClaudeIntegration`)
- **Natural language parsing** - Describe your document in plain English
- **Streaming responses** - Real-time feedback during generation
- **Interactive sessions** - Refine requirements through conversation
- **Multiple document types** - Budget trackers, workout logs, and more
### Predefined Templates
1. **Budget Tracker** (`DocumentGeneration.Excel.budget_tracker/1`)
- Category-based expense tracking
- Automatic variance calculations
- Percentage of budget formulas
- Professional financial styling
2. **Workout Log** (`DocumentGeneration.Excel.workout_log/1`)
- Date-based workout tracking
- Duration and calorie logging
- Summary statistics sheet
- Cross-sheet formula references

## Programmatic Usage
### Basic Excel Generation
```elixir
alias DocumentGeneration.Excel
# Create a simple spreadsheet
Excel.create_workbook("Report")
|> Excel.add_sheet("Data")
|> Excel.set_row("Data", 1, ["Name", "Value"], bold: true)
|> Excel.set_row("Data", 2, ["Revenue", 50000])
|> Excel.set_row("Data", 3, ["Expenses", 35000])
|> Excel.set_formula("Data", "B4", "B2-B3")
|> Excel.write_to_file("report.xlsx")
```
### Using Templates
```elixir
# Budget tracker
categories = [
%{name: "Housing", budget: 1500, actual: 1450},
%{name: "Food", budget: 600, actual: 580}
]
{:ok, workbook} = DocumentGeneration.create_budget_tracker(categories)
DocumentGeneration.save(workbook, "budget.xlsx")
# Workout log
workouts = [
%{date: ~D[2025-01-01], exercise: "Running", duration: 30, calories: 300}
]
{:ok, workbook} = DocumentGeneration.create_workout_log(workouts)
DocumentGeneration.save(workbook, "workout.xlsx")
```
### From Natural Language
```elixir
# Parse specification and generate
spec = "Monthly Budget: Housing $1500, Food $600, Transport $400"
{:ok, workbook} = DocumentGeneration.generate_budget(spec)
DocumentGeneration.save(workbook, "budget.xlsx")
```
### With Claude AI
```elixir
alias DocumentGeneration.ClaudeIntegration
# Generate with AI interpretation
{:ok, workbook} = ClaudeIntegration.generate_document(
"Create a budget for a small startup with typical expenses",
type: :budget_tracker,
model: "sonnet"
)
```

## Example Output
### Budget Tracker
The budget tracker generates an Excel file with:
| Category | Budget | Actual | Variance | % of Budget |
|----------|--------|--------|----------|-------------|
| Housing | $1,500.00 | $1,450.00 | $-50.00 | 96.7% |
| Food | $600.00 | $580.00 | $-20.00 | 96.7% |
| Transport | $400.00 | $420.00 | $20.00 | 105.0% |
| **TOTAL** | **$2,500.00** | **$2,450.00** | **$-50.00** | **98.0%** |
Features:
- Blue header row with white text
- Currency formatting
- Variance formulas (`=C2-B2`)
- Percentage formulas (`=C2/B2`)
- Green/red conditional formatting for variance
- SUM formulas in totals row
### Workout Log
The workout log generates a multi-sheet workbook:
**Workouts Sheet:**
| Date | Exercise | Duration (min) | Calories |
|------|----------|----------------|----------|
| 2025-01-01 | Running | 30 | 300 |
| 2025-01-02 | Weights | 45 | 200 |
**Summary Sheet:**
| Metric | Value |
|--------|-------|
| Total Workouts | 2 |
| Total Duration (min) | =SUM(Workouts!C2:C3) |
| Total Calories | =SUM(Workouts!D2:D3) |
| Average Duration | =AVERAGE(Workouts!C2:C3) |

## Extending
### Adding New Document Types
1. Create a new function in `DocumentGeneration.Excel`:
```elixir
def invoice(items) do
create_workbook("Invoice")
|> add_sheet("Invoice")
|> setup_invoice_headers()
|> add_invoice_items(items)
end
```
2. Add parsing in `DocumentGeneration.Generator`:
```elixir
def parse_invoice_spec(spec) do
# Extract invoice items from natural language
end
```
3. Create a Mix task in `lib/mix/tasks/generate.invoice.ex`
### Custom Styling
```elixir
alias DocumentGeneration.Styles
# Create custom header style
custom_header = Styles.header_style(color: "#FF5722", font_size: 14)
# Merge styles
combined = Styles.merge_styles(
Styles.currency_style(),
Styles.positive_style()
)
```
## Troubleshooting
### "Application not started" Error
Ensure you start required applications:
```elixir
Application.ensure_all_started(:elixlsx)
Application.ensure_all_started(:claude_agent_sdk)
```
### Formula Errors in Excel
- Check cell references are correct
- Ensure referenced cells exist before the formula
- Use `Styles.cell_reference/2` for dynamic references
### Claude Integration Issues
- Verify `ANTHROPIC_API_KEY` is set
- Check you're authenticated with `claude login`
- Try simpler prompts first
